Kidney disease is a leading causes of gout, a painful arthritis caused by build up of uric acid in the body. Kidney disease & gout have a mutual relationship - either one could cause the other. Learn about the symptoms of gout & it’s tie to kidney disease: bit.ly/3VDax7N

Approximately 23% of patients with chronic kidney disease meet the criteria for gout, of whom 13% have uncontrolled gout and 36% have no formal gout diagnosis, according to new data. ow.ly/yeCi50RmNVN

Currently, more than 800,000 Americans live with ESRD and more than 550,000 are on dialysis, and well over 200,000 living with a kidney transplant. ow.ly/wyHg50RmNUP

About 35 million Americans are living with kidney disease, but as many as nine out of 10 people don’t know they have it, according to the Centers of Disease Control and Prevention. ow.ly/us3p50Re8uP
